Mortgage Loan Application Detail Totals for Waterstone Mortgage Corporation in 2009

Loan Purpose

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Refinancing 2,117 $448,106,000 $211,000 $1,050,000 $98,000 $1,685,000
Home Purchase 1,178 $201,148,000 $170,000 $911,000 $76,000 $541,000
Home Improvement 5 $1,448,000 $289,000 $700,000 $159,000 $276,000

Applicant Race

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
White 2,783 $549,248,000 $197,000 $1,050,000 $91,000 $1,685,000
Not Provided 274 $58,776,000 $214,000 $417,000 $101,000 $422,000
Hispanic 116 $18,603,000 $160,000 $395,000 $49,000 $214,000
Asian 66 $14,449,000 $218,000 $522,000 $128,000 $882,000
Black or African American 44 $6,297,000 $143,000 $356,000 $52,000 $181,000
American Indian or Alaskan Native 10 $2,051,000 $205,000 $352,000 $67,000 $120,000
Native Hawaiian or Other Pacific Islander 7 $1,278,000 $182,000 $295,000 $87,000 $150,000
Not applicable 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0

Loan Type

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Conventional (any loan other than FHA, VA, FSA, or RHS loans) 2,205 $459,796,000 $208,000 $1,050,000 $107,000 $1,685,000
FHA-insured (Federal Housing Administration) 941 $158,809,000 $168,000 $717,000 $55,000 $352,000
VA-guaranteed (Veterans Administration) 150 $31,630,000 $210,000 $611,000 $59,000 $306,000
FSA/RHS (Farm Service Agency or Rural Housing Service) 4 $467,000 $116,000 $156,000 $33,000 $52,000

Outcome

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Loan Originated 3,053 $599,117,000 $196,000 $717,000 $89,000 $1,685,000
Application Withdrawn By Applicant 115 $23,528,000 $204,000 $911,000 $103,000 $517,000
Application Denied By Financial Institution 112 $23,503,000 $209,000 $1,050,000 $114,000 $1,455,000
Application Approved But Not Accepted 11 $2,874,000 $261,000 $700,000 $105,000 $258,000
File Closed For Incompleteness 9 $1,680,000 $186,000 $303,000 $80,000 $190,000
Loan Purchased By The Institution 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
Preapproval Approved but not Accepted 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
Preapproval Denied by Financial Institution 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0

Denial Reason

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Collateral 38 $7,504,000 $197,000 $600,000 $103,000 $517,000
Debt-To-Income Ratio 15 $2,589,000 $172,000 $417,000 $58,000 $155,000
Other 13 $2,898,000 $222,000 $417,000 $147,000 $636,000
Employment History 12 $2,009,000 $167,000 $290,000 $56,000 $161,000
Credit History 11 $2,392,000 $217,000 $900,000 $195,000 $1,455,000
Unverifiable Information 9 $2,969,000 $329,000 $1,050,000 $262,000 $1,117,000
Mortgage Insurance Denied 5 $1,091,000 $218,000 $296,000 $63,000 $72,000
Credit Application Incomplete 3 $864,000 $288,000 $388,000 $98,000 $109,000
Insufficient Cash (Downpayment, Closing Cost) 2 $512,000 $256,000 $417,000 $52,000 $69,000
